This patch includes the following modifications and problem resolutions: 1) TREATMENT ABBREVIATED (#165.5,42) The field TREATMENT PLAN has been renamed TREATMENT ABBREVIATED. 2) SUS *..Casefinding/Suspense ... [ONCO SUSPENSE MENU] RA Automatic Casefinding-Radiology Search [ONCO SUSPENSE-CASEFIND (RAD)] If two or more patients in the RAD/NUC MED PATIENT (#70) file had identical EXAM DATE (#70.02,.01) values, the [Automatic Casefinding-Radiology Search] option was only checking the first patient for suspicious malignancies and skipping subsequent patients with the same EXAM DATE. This has been fixed. 3) ABS *..Abstracting/Printing ... [ONCO ABSTRACT MENU] MA Print QA/Multiple Abstracts [ONCO ABSTRACT-MULTIPLE] 1 QA Abstract a) In patch ONC*2.11*44 a new option, [Print Abstract QA (80c)], was added. This option replaced the [Print Abstract-Brief (80c)] option. The [Print QA/Multiple Abstracts][QA Abstract] option was still tied to the [Print Abstract-Brief (80c)] report. This has been fixed. b) The QA REGISTRY ABSTRACTS checklist was only associated with the [QA - 10% Complete abstracts] menu selection. This has been changed. If the registrars selects the [QA Abstract] menu selection, the QA REGISTRY ABSTRACTS checklist will display with all of the following menu selections: 1 All abstracts, One PATIENT 2 All abstracts, One SITE/GP 3 All abstracts, One ACCESSION YEAR, One SITE/GP 4 All abstracts, One ACCESSION YEAR 5 Complete Abstracts by DATE DX 6 QA - 10% Complete abstracts 4) ABS *..Abstracting/Printing ... [ONCO ABSTRACT MENU] QA Print Abstract QA (80c) [ONCO ABSTRACT QA] CLASS OF CASE (#165.5,.04) DIAGNOSTIC CONFIRMATION (#165.5,26) CLASS OF CASE and DIAGNOSTIC CONFIRMATION have been added to the CANCER IDENTIFICATION section of the [QA Print Abstract QA (80c)] report. 5) EXTENSION (CS) (#165.5,30.2) stuffing For Hematopoietic, Reticuloendothelial, Immunoproliferative, and Myeloproliferative Neoplasms, EXTENSION (CS) be will stuffed with 80 (Systemic disease) with the following exceptions. EXTENSION (CS) will NOT be stuffed with 80 for the following histologies. These may be coded with 10 (Localized disease) or 80 (Systemic disease). Plasmacytoma, NOS (M-9731/3)(solitary myeloma) Mast cell sarcoma (M-9740) Malignant histiocytosis (M-9750) Histiocytic sarcoma (M-9755) Langerhans cell sarcoma (M-9756) Dendritic cell sarcoma (M-9757, M-9758) Myeloid sarcoma (M-9930) 6) OVERRIDE HOSPSEQ/DXCONF flag If the registrar encounters the following inter-field edit WARNING he/she will now be asked if they want to set the OVERRIDE HOSPSEQ/DXCONF flag to "Reviewed". e.g. ABSTRACT STATUS: Incomplete// C Complete All required data fields have been entered. Y// ES No inter-field edit check warnings. 7) SEQUENCE NUMBER (#165.5,.06) The SEQUENCE NUMBER DESCRIPTION has been modified to more closely match the FORDS "Instructions for Coding" on page 34 of the FORDS manual. The sequence number range for in situ and malignant neoplasms has been expanded from 00-35 to 00-59. 8) NAACCR item: Patient ID Number [20] 2-9 The NAACCR data item "Patient ID Number" was being extracted with a value of "00000000". With the implementation of Edits Metafile 11.0B this item must now be either or greater than zero. "Patient ID Number" will now be extracted with a value of "99999999". 9) NAACCR GenEdits errors Conflict among RX Hosp--Surg Prim Site, Primary Site, and Histologic Type ICD-O-3 Conflict among RX Summ--Surg Prim Site, Primary Site, and Histologic Type ICD-O-3 In order to resolve the above NAACCR v11.0 edit errors, S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) (#165.5,58.6) and SURGERY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) (#165.5,58.7) will be stuffed with code 98 for all C42.0, C42.1, C42.3, C42.4, C76.0-C76.8, and C80.9 cases. NOTE: Any existing C42.0, C42.1, C42.3, C42.4, C76.0-C76.8, or C80.9 cases will have their S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) and SURGEY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) values converted to 98. 10) SARCOMAS AND RARE TUMORS OF THE LUNG (C34.) HEMANGIOSARCOMA (9120/3) AND MESENCHYMOMA, MALIGNANT (8990/3) OF SOFT TISSUE SARCOMA a) For LUNG (C34.) cases, if the associated histology appears in the Collaborative Staging Histology Exclusion Table for Lung, the TNM staging fields will be stuffed with the "no staging" values. b) For SOFT TISSUE SARCOMA cases, if the associated histology is HEMANGIOSARCOMA (9120/3) or MESENCHYMOMA, MALIGNANT (8990/3), the TNM staging fields will be stuffed with the "no staging" values. e.g. A lung case with the histology 8802/3 GIANT CELL SARCOMA will be stuffed as follows: No TNM coding/staging available for sarcomas and rare tumors of the lung. CLINICAL T: T88 NA CLINICAL N: N88 NA CLINICAL M: M88 NA STAGE GROUP CLINICAL: NA STAGED BY (CLINICAL STAGE): Not staged MULTIMODALITY THERAPY (PATH): NO PATHOLOGIC T: T88 NA PATHOLOGIC N: N88 NA PATHOLOGIC M: M88 NA STAGE GROUP PATHOLOGIC: NA STAGED BY (PATHOLOGIC STAGE): Not staged The Histology Exclusion Table for Lung can be found at: http://web.facs.org/cstage/lung/Lungajcchistologiestable.html 11) REASON NO SURGERY OF PRIMARY (#165.5,58) REASON FOR NO RADIATION (#165.5,75) CHEMOTHERAPY (#165.5,53.2) CHEMOTHERAPY @FAC (#165.5,53.3) HORMONE THERAPY (#165.5,54.2) HORMONE THERAPY @FAC (#165.5,54.3) IMMUNOTHERAPY (#165.5,55.2) IMMUNOTHERAPY @FAC (#165.5,55.3) HEMA TRANS/ENDOCRINE PROC (#165.5,153) The code definitions for the above data items have been modified for greater clarity and consistency. 12) NEW DATA ITEMS/NEW OPTION PSA DATE (#165.5,96) DRE +/- (#165.5,102) DRE DATE (#165.5,156) TNM FORM ASSIGNED (#165.5,25) TNM FORM COMPLETED (#165.5,44) CAP PROTOCOL REVIEW (#165.5,46) CAP TEXT (#165.5,47) ELAPSED DAYS TO COMPLETION (#165.5,157) UTL *..Utility Options ... [ONCO UTIL MENU] TNM Compute percentage of TNM forms completed [ONC TNM FORMS COMPLETE %] Eight new data items have been added to the ONCOLOGY PRIMARY (#165.5) file: ----------------------------------------------------------------------- 1) PSA DATE Records the date on which the Prostate Specific Antigen (PSA) test was performed. 2) DRE +/- Records the findings of a DRE (Digital Rectal Examination). 3) DRE DATE Records the date on which the DRE (Digital Rectal Examination) was performed. PSA DATE, DRE +/- and DRE DATE have been placed in the "Cancer Identification" section of the abstract. They will only appear for PROSTATE (C61.9) cases.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- 4) TNM FORM ASSIGNED Records the date on which the TNM form was assigned to the Managing Physician. 5) TNM FORM COMPLETED Records the date on which the TNM form was completed by the Managing Physician. TNM FORM ASSIGNED and TNM FORM COMPLETED have been placed in the "Stage of Disease at Diagnosis" section of the abstract after the data items PHYSICIAN'S STAGE and PHYSICIAN STAGING. If the case does not support staging, TNM FORM ASSIGNED and TNM FORM COMPLETED will be stuffed with "00/00/0000". A new option, [TNM Compute percentage of TNM forms completed], has been added to the [UTL *..Utility Options...] menu. This option will compute the percentage of TNM Forms assigned which have been completed.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- 6) CAP PROTOCOL REVIEW ACoS requires CAP (College of American Pathologists) Protocol Review of cases with surgical resection only. This data item records the status of this review. 7) CAP TEXT Records the reason for CAP (College of American Pathologists) Protocol non-compliance. CAP PROTOCOL REVIEW and CAP TEXT have been placed in the "First Course of Treatment" section of the abstract after the data item RX TEXT-SURGERY. The registrar will only be prompted for CAP TEXT if CAP PROTOCOL REVIEW has a value of 0 (Failed). ----------------------------------------------------------------------- 8) ELAPSED DAYS TO COMPLETION Computes the time interval in days between DATE OF FIRST CONTACT (165.5,155) and DATE CASE COMPLETED (165.5,90). ELAPSED DAYS TO COMPLETION will be computed as needed. All of these data items will appear on the [PA Print Complete Abstract (132c)] report. 13) ABS *..Abstracting/Printing ... [ONCO ABSTRACT MENU] NC Print Abstract NOT Complete List [ONCO ABSTRACT-NOT COMPLETE] The PRIMARY ABSTRACT NOT-COMPLETE Report has been changed. The column containing PRIMARY SITE values has been replaced with a column containing SITE/GP values. Also, SUBCOUNT and COUNT totals have been added to this report. 14) DATE RADIATION STARTED (#165.5,51) REASON FOR NO RADIATION (#165.5,75) If REASON FOR NO RADIATION equals 8 ( Recommended, unknown if admin), DATE RADIATION STARTED (165.5,51) must equal 88/88/8888 (when radiation is planned as part of the first course of therapy, but had not been started at the time of the most recent follow-up). If the registrar enters a REASON FOR NO RADIATION value of 8, the program will change DATE RADIATION STARTED to 88/88/8888. This change will prevent the EDITS error "Reason for No Radiation and RX Date--Radiation conflict". Any existing cases which have a REASON FOR NO RADIATION value of 8 will have the corresponding DATE RADIATION STARTED value changed to 88/88/8888. 15) CHEMOTHERAPY (#165.5,53.2) HORMONE THERAPY (#165.5,54.2) IMMUMOTHERAPY (#165.5,55.2) HEMA TRANS/ENDOCRINE PROC (#165.5,153) If a value of 88 (Recommended, unknown if admin) is entered for any of the above systemic therapies, their corresponding therapy date will be stuffed with 88/88/8888. Any existing cases which have a systemic therapy value of 88 will have the corresponding therapy date value changed to 88/88/8888. 16) FOLLOW-UP FORM LETTER (#165.1) Last 4 digits of SSN Per HIPAA security regulations, all FOLLOW-UP FORM LETTERs will now display only the last 4 digits of the SSN. Any existing letters will have their SSN values converted. Any future locally created letters should use the syntax |$E(SSN,8,11)| for displaying SSN values. 17) SUS *..Casefinding/Suspense ... [ONCO SUSPENSE MENU] PT Automatic Casefinding-PTF Search [ONCO SUSPENSE-CASEFIND (PTF)] PTF casefinding has been modified to include a search for ICD-9 code 285.0 (SIDEROBLASTIC ANEMIA). Also, the list of ICD-9 codes to be searched for included code V77.1 (SCREENING FOR DIABETES MELLITUS). This was incorrect. The correct code listing should be V71.1 (OBSV-SUSPCT MAL NEOPLASM). This has been fixed. 18) NAACCR item: ICD Revision Comorbid [3165] 737-737 For 2006+ cases which have no reportable comorbidities or complications the NAACCR item "ICD Revision Comorbid" was being extracted with a value of . This was generating the following EDITS error: ICD Revision Comorbid, Date of DX (COC) E: If year of Date of Diagnosis > 2005, then ICD Revision Comorbid E: cannot be blank This has been fixed. All cases which have no reportable comorbidities or complications will now get an "ICD Revision Comorbid" value of 0 (No secondary diagnosis reported). NOTE: Due to privacy restrictions, not all comorbidities and complications are "reportable" to external institutions (e.g. state registries, NCDB). For this reason some cases which have comorbidities and complications recorded in VistA may receive an "ICD Revision Comorbid" value of 0 (No secondary diagnosis reported). 19) NAACCR item: Vendor Name [1270] 1204-1202 In order to differentiate between the VACCR and STATE extracts the NAACCR item "Vendor Name" has been enhanced to include a suffix identifier. The "Vendor Name" value for the VACCR extract will now have a suffix of "A" (e.g. VAV11P46A). The "Vendor Name" value for the STATE extract will now have a suffix of "B" (e.g. VAV11P46B). The NCDB extract will have no suffix identifier. 20) Site-Specific Surgery Codes Spleen C42.2 S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) (165.5,58.6) SURGERY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) (165.5,58.7) The selectable surgery codes for S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) and SURGERY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) for spleen cases were ROADS codes. They are now the correct FORDS codes. Spleen cases with a S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) or SURGERY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) value of 10 (Local excision, destruction, NOS) will have this value converted to 19 (Local tumor destruction or excision, NOS). Spleen cases with a SURGERY OF PRIMARY (F) or SURGERY OF PRIMARY @FAC (F) value of 20 (Splenectomy, NOS (spleen primary only)) will have this value converted to 80 (Splenectomy, NOS). 21) FOLLOW-UP RATE FOR ALL PATIENTS (LIVING AND DEAD) [UTL *..Utility Options ...] [RS Registry Summary Reports] [F Follow-Up] There was a typo in line (F) of the follow-up rate report. The text read "(** should be 90%)". This was incorrect. It should read "(** should be 80%)". This has been fixed. 22) PROHIBITING FUTURE DATES Patch ONC*2.11*44 included several new date fields. These fields were allowing the entry of future dates. This was incorrect. Future dates are now prohibited for the following data items: DATE OF FIRST SYMPTOMS (#165.5,171) DATE START OF WORKUP ORDERED (#165.5,172) DATE WORKUP STARTED (#165.5,173) DATE OF BLOOD IN SPUTUM PER PT (#165.5,174.1) DATE OF CHEST X-RAY (#165.5,175.1) DATE OF CT SCAN (#165.5,176.1) DATE OF BRONCHOSCOPY (#165.5,177.1) DATE OF MEDIASTINOSCOPY (#165.5,178.1) DATE OF PET SCAN (#165.5,179.1) DATE OF CHANGE IN BOWEL HABITS (#165.5,180.1) DATE OF FOBT (#165.5,181.1) DATE OF BARIUM ENEMA (#165.5,182.1) DATE OF SIGMOIDOSCOPY (#165.5,183.1) DATE OF CT OF ABDOMEN/PELVIS (#165.5,184.1) DATE OF COLONOSCOPY (#165.5,185.1) DATE OF DYSPNEA (#165.5,186.1) DATE OF INCREASED COUGH (#165.5,187.1) DATE OF FEVER (#165.5,188.1) DATE OF NIGHT SWEATS (#165.5,189.1) 23) COLLABORATIVE STAGING VERSION 01.03.00 CS Restage CS cases using latest version [ONCO UTIL-CS RESTAGING] A new option has been added the [UTL *..Utility Options ...] menu: [CS Restage CS cases using latest version] This option will search for 2004+ cases which have been previously staged with an earlier version of the CS algorithm and restage them using CS Version 01.03.00. Cases which encounter CS errors or warnings during restaging will display an error message identifying the problem case by PID, PRIMARY SITE and ACCESSION/SEQUENCE NUMBER. e.g. B0036 C32.1 200600004/02 encountered a CS warning These cases should be reviewed and restaged manually. 24) SUS *..Casefinding/Suspense ... [ONCO SUSPENSE MENU] RA Automatic Casefinding-Radiology Search [ONCO SUSPENSE-CASEFIND (RAD)] The RADIOLOGY CASEFINDING LIST report header was displaying the "site" name. It has been changed to display the DIVISION name. 25) NASAL CAVITY (C30.0) and SINUS, ETHMOID (C31.1) CLINICAL T (#165.5,37.1) For 6th Edition NASAL CAVITY and SINUS,ETHMOID cases code 88 (NA) was not available for CLINICAL T selection. This has been fixed. 26) PLASMA CELL DISORDERS BONE MARROW C42.1 MULTIPLE MYELOMA 9732/3 SCOPE OF LN SURGERY (F) (#165.5,138.4) SCOPE OF LN SURGERY @FAC (F) (#165.5,138.5) For a "no treatment" BONE MARROW (C42.1) case with an histology of MULTIPLE MYELOMA (9732/3), SCOPE OF LN SURGERY (F) and SCOPE OF LN SURGERY @FAC were being stuffed with code 0 (None). This was incorrect. The correct code is 9 (Unknown/NA). This has been fixed. Any existing cases which meet this criteria will have their SCOPE OF LN SURGERY and SCOPE OF LN SURGERY @FAC values converted to 9.
